need help with some electrical set up
 
got a 1974 911 s that i want to install some LED light on the inside here is what i wan to achieve than when the doors open and the dome light turn on also turn on the LED on the inside here is where come complicated i want also to turn on the LED light by itself by a switch on the inside but just the light not the dome lights, someone said me to put a relay but what kind of relay and how i can connected it. any help or opinions will be greatful

You could use two diodes, one diode for the dome source and the other diode for the switch source. The source connects to the anode of the diode. The two cathodes are tied together and connect to the LED load. The diodes will drop a little less than a volt, so make sure your LED’s will function OK with this reduced voltage.

T77911S 05-29-2018 07:48 AM

you would have to connect your LED light after the switch in the door but you would have to install a diode in line with the wire from the door switch to the LED.
then you would have to connect your LED switch between the diode and the LED. the diode blocks the voltage from going back and turning on the dome light.

the cathode (the | side) needs to be connected to the LED to block current flow back to the dome light
